'Trashed and toxic transitions?' The environmental burden from climate and energy transitions that go wrong. 

The sustainability of a just energy transition towards a low-carbon economy is at risk. Trade- offs between low-carbon but high-material, high-waste, and high-toxicity scenarios need to be critically examined in an inter- and transdisciplinary manner.

This Public Square brings together an interdisciplinary core team to address this complex issue in partnership with other academics and non-academic players.
